One-stop-shop opens in Capitol

ALABEL, Sarangani (January 13, 2022) – Delia Gegone (left), 36, from Barangay Tokawal, processes the renewal of her delivery van permit on January 4 during the conduct of the annual one-stop-shop at the Capitol covered court. The one-stop-shop was established by the Provincial Treasurer's Office (PTO) to streamline and fast-track the processes involved in the renewal and application of the Governor’s Permit as well as for the collection of the provincial local tax impositions. Amelia Catolico, acting revenue generation division chief, said that for this year’s one-stop-shop “clients can immediately get their permits after processing all the requirements sa isang proseso lang.” She disclosed,” dati kasi to be followed pa yung ating permits but now we have integrated to offer a more convenient transaction for our clients.” Provincial local tax impositions, according to Catolico, are composed of tax on the transfer of real property ownership; business of printing and publication tax; franchise tax; tax on sand and gravel; amusement tax; annual fixed tax for every delivery truck or van/vehicle; and professional tax. Catolico also urged clients to go to the one-stop-shop "as early as possible" to avoid the crowd of applicants during the last week of the renewal. The one-stop shop will run until January 20 from 8 am to 5 pm at the Capitol covered court. (Jake Narte-Joshua John Pantonial/SARANGANI PROVINCIAL INFORMATION OFFICE)
